Louise leakey is a kenyan paleontologist and anthropologist, and the youngest documented person to find a hominoid fossil [2] in 1993, she replaced her father richard leakey as field expedition leader for turkana paleontological expeditions in one of the most arid and. She is the daughter of richard leakey and meave leakey, and the wife of prince emmanuel de merode.
Louise leakey is a famed paleontologist and the director of public education and outreach for the turkana basin institute. Now, the leakey family is synonymous with the study of human evolution, with three generations making important contributions to science.
Researcher on human origins and evolution She leads the koobi fora research project and focuses on the period between 2 and 1.5 million years ago. A national geographic explorer at large, she is the daughter of meave and richard leakey, and granddaughter of louis and mary leakey. Louise leakey is the third generation of her family to dig for humanity's past in east africa
She has discovered fossils of homo habilis and kenyanthropus platyops, and challenges the conventional view of human evolution.
